The Tinker Memorial Bataan Death March being held March 22 (6:30 a.m.-5:30 p.m.) is a ruck, run, walk, or bike in memory of those that came together and valiantly fought together for freedom ultimately resulting in the loss during World War II of over 10,000 souls, bringing to light our resiliency as a nation and the need to have an always ready force.
Participants will travel 26.2, 14.2, or 3.2 miles within 8 hours. Teams of five can also participate. To sign up or learn more, follow the links below.
